Dr Hugo Hiden
Principal Research Associate
- Telephone: +44 191 208 4149
Hugo Hiden is a Principal Research Associate in the School of Computing Science at Newcastle University. His current role is as the software development lead on the Mobilise-D and SUSTAIN projects, which are developing clinically validated Digital Mobility Measurements for a range of degenerative diseases including Parkinsons, COPD, MS and Conjestive Heart Failure.
He is also the principal developer of the e-Science Central platform, a cloud based data processing system which has been used in a number of academic and commercial contexts. Prior to his University role, he spent 6 years in industry developing advanced data integration, analysis and modelling tools at Avantium Technologies and GSE Systems Inc. Hugo holds a PhD in the application of Genetic Programming to chemical process data analysis and has published numerous papers on the subjects of cloud computing, process monitoring, computer security and collaborative R&D.
